在開發過程中,總有一些需求是需要查看在A表中ID不存在於B表中的ID的情況: 下面有三種方法可以實現這一需求: 第一種:使用Not in 方法通過子查詢的結果集來做過濾: 這種情況最常見也是最容易理解的邏輯SQL代碼,但是會有很多問題出現。 首先,這種情況是針對數據量比較 ...
原文地址:exp導出一個表中符合查詢條件的數據作者:charsi 導出一個表中的部分數據,使用QUERY參數,如下導出select from test where object id gt 這個條件中的數據expcharsi charsi testdbtables TEST query where object id gt file aaa.dmp log aaa.log 其他參數含義:GRAN ...
2018-06-03 10:27 0 1314 推薦指數:
在開發過程中,總有一些需求是需要查看在A表中ID不存在於B表中的ID的情況: 下面有三種方法可以實現這一需求: 第一種:使用Not in 方法通過子查詢的結果集來做過濾: 這種情況最常見也是最容易理解的邏輯SQL代碼,但是會有很多問題出現。 首先,這種情況是針對數據量比較 ...
update A set A.COLUMN2=(select distinct(B.COLUMN2) from B where B.ID=A.ID ); ...
舉個例子:用select * from all_objects創建了一張表T。想要導出object_id小於5000的所有行。(1)windows下: exp userid=cms0929/cms0929 table=t query="""where object_id < 5000 ...
說明: -t:只導數據 --where:條件 --triggers=false:不導觸發器 --replace:使用REPLACE INTO 取代INSERT INTO 參數大全: --all-databases , -A 導出全部數據 ...
mysqldump -uroot -pdsideal -t dsideal_db t_resource_info --where="res_type=1 and group_id=1 and ts&g ...
單表: HAVING過濾 二次篩選 只能是group by 之后的字段 1.查詢各崗位內包含的員工個數小於2的崗位名、崗位內包含員工名字、個數 select post,group_concat(name),count(1) from employee group by post ...
select *from 表2where 姓名 in (select 姓名from 表1where 條件) 這個就是用一個表的查詢結果當作條件去查詢另一個表的數據 ...
代碼格式如下: 要注意的是:in后面的查詢語句必須是查詢一個字段跟前面的表相對應的。比如要根據訂單號orderID,OpenBills 這個表就需要查詢到orderID這個字段,BillConsume這個表的條件就要判斷orderID ...